Article
52 If anyone, in violation of the provisions
in Article 30 of this Law, publishes publications which
contain such contents as may induce juveniles to violate
laws or commit criminal offenses, or such contents as
may impair the physical and mental health of juveniles,
contents that exaggerate violence, pornography, gambling,
terror, etc., the publications and his illegal gains
shall be confiscated by the administrative department
for publishing, and he shall also be fined not less
than three times but not more than 10 times his illegal
gains; if the circumstances are serious, the publications
and his illegal gains shall be confiscated, he shall
be ordered to suspend business for rectification or
his license shall be revoked. The persons who are directly
in charge and the other persons who are directly responsible
shall be fined.
Whoever produces or reproduces
publications for juveniles which propagate obscenity
or sells, loans or spreads such publications shall be
punished for public security in accordance with law;
if the violation constitutes a crime, he shall be investigated
for criminal responsibility in accordance with law.
